Waterfront Mexican spot with fast, friendly service, crowd-pleasing plates and free chips with warm queso; quality is generally good though consistency and waitlist handling can vary.
Miguel's Cocina delivers solid neighborhood dining with exceptional waterfront appeal and attentive service that elevate the experience. Food quality is above average with standout fajitas and house salsas, but inconsistent execution—cold fajitas, dry enchiladas, bland queso on off nights—prevents higher grades. The generous portions and bay views make it worth visiting for casual family meals, though reliability concerns keep it from competing with the area's more consistent dining destinations.
